Yalding station provides several essential amenities for travelers. Though it lacks a 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for you to purchase or collect your pre-bought tickets. Great emphasis is placed on accessibility; induction loops and accessible ticket machines are provided for convenience. For assistance, the station has designated help points, and additional support is available on trains. However, do note that the station does not have waiting rooms, toilets, or refreshment services, so plan accordingly before arriving.
Accessibility at stations is paramount, and Yalding offers partial step-free access. Specifically, platform 1 benefits from ease of access monitored by staff who assist on the trains. However, reach platform 2 requires maneuvering via a footbridge. If assistance is needed, especially for those with impaired mobility, arrangements can be made in advance with the station's mobile Assistance Team. Unfortunately, facilities like accessible toilets, and accessible taxi services are currently unavailable.

The station offers essential facilities to ensure a smooth journey. The ticket office, open from early morning until late evening, provides both in-person ticket sales and machines for convenient online ticket collection. It’s important to note that while the ticket machines are available, they are not accessible for all. However, the station does feature step-free access to all platforms, making it user-friendly for passengers with mobility challenges.
Safety and assistance are priorities at Sandwell & Dudley. Staff are available to help during the operating hours of the ticket office, and the station is equipped with CCTV for added security. For personalized travel assistance, you can rely on the Passenger Assist service, which allows for assistance bookings up to two hours before travel. Luggage storage isn’t available, but rest assured, the Secure Station Scheme accreditation underlines its commitment to passenger security.
The station is well-connected to other modes of transportation, enhancing your travel flexibility. For those occasions when rail replacement services are required, buses operate from the station entrance on McKean Road. A variety of local taxi services, such as Sandwell, Dudley, and Oldbury taxi companies, ensure that you can reach your next destination with ease.
While there aren't facilities on-site for refreshments or shops, nearby areas offer options for dining and shopping, allowing you to stretch your legs and grab a bite or two. Note that the station lacks public Wi-Fi and pay phones, so plan accordingly, especially if connectivity is crucial for your travels.
